Dartmouth Health’s Department of Orthopaedics at the Dartmouth-Hitchcock Medical Center in Lebanon, NH is seeking to hire a Board Eligible/Certified Foot and Ankle Orthopaedic Surgeon to join a collaborative and multidisciplinary academic practice. This position offers the opportunity to practice in a high-acuity, high-volume environment while contributing to the institution’s missions of clinical excellence, education, and scholarly activity. The successful candidate will join an established division and provide comprehensive foot and ankle care within an integrated healthcare system. The role will be based out of Dartmouth-Hitchcock Medical Center, with additional clinical responsibilities at affiliate hospitals, all located within the Upper Valley, offering a short and convenient commute between sites. The position includes participation in a team-based academic practice, as well as shared Level I trauma call consistent with departmental needs. Academic responsibilities may include teaching and mentoring medical students and residents in both clinical and educational settings. It is expected that your clinical practice would have a focus on clinical research aimed at advancing the clinical mission of the department and Geisel School of Medicine at Dartmouth. With this, you will also hold a faculty appointment at the Geisel School of Medicine and will fully participate in the research, education, and clinical programs of the Foot and Ankle Division and the Department.
